Output 2112417353f173d6e5cd96b6e1196652fbb9e845b7fee3106e8d6410466f169f:3

value
75906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a90cc1e2a4b666d4826587a4e10a91285f974c8 OP_EQUAL
address
3EKgdiE24jj3n27sTA8nDAVPDU9fuhepQY
transaction
2112417353f173d6e5cd96b6e1196652fbb9e845b7fee3106e8d6410466f169f
spent
true